960件ヒット
[1-100件を表示]
(0.059秒)
別のキーワード
種類
- 特異メソッド (624)
- インスタンスメソッド (300)
- モジュール関数 (36)
ライブラリ
- digest (96)
-
digest
/ bubblebabble (12) -
digest
/ sha2 (12) -
net
/ imap (12) - openssl (696)
-
rubygems
/ digest / digest _ adapter (24) -
webrick
/ httpauth / digestauth (48) -
webrick
/ httpauth / htdigest (60)
クラス
-
Digest
:: Base (72) -
Digest
:: SHA2 (12) -
Gem
:: DigestAdapter (24) -
Net
:: IMAP (12) -
OpenSSL
:: Cipher (12) -
OpenSSL
:: Digest (48) -
OpenSSL
:: Digest :: DSS (36) -
OpenSSL
:: Digest :: DSS1 (36) -
OpenSSL
:: Digest :: Digest (12) -
OpenSSL
:: Digest :: MD2 (36) -
OpenSSL
:: Digest :: MD4 (36) -
OpenSSL
:: Digest :: MD5 (36) -
OpenSSL
:: Digest :: MDC2 (36) -
OpenSSL
:: Digest :: RIPEMD160 (36) -
OpenSSL
:: Digest :: SHA (36) -
OpenSSL
:: Digest :: SHA1 (36) -
OpenSSL
:: Digest :: SHA224 (36) -
OpenSSL
:: Digest :: SHA256 (36) -
OpenSSL
:: Digest :: SHA384 (36) -
OpenSSL
:: Digest :: SHA512 (36) -
OpenSSL
:: Engine (12) -
OpenSSL
:: HMAC (36) -
OpenSSL
:: Netscape :: SPKI (12) -
OpenSSL
:: OCSP :: CertificateId (12) -
OpenSSL
:: PKCS7 :: SignerInfo (12) -
OpenSSL
:: PKey :: PKey (24) -
OpenSSL
:: X509 :: CRL (12) -
OpenSSL
:: X509 :: Certificate (12) -
OpenSSL
:: X509 :: Request (12) -
WEBrick
:: HTTPAuth :: DigestAuth (48) -
WEBrick
:: HTTPAuth :: Htdigest (60)
モジュール
- Digest (24)
- Kernel (12)
-
OpenSSL
:: PKCS5 (12)
キーワード
- << (24)
- == (24)
- authenticate (24)
- bubblebabble (12)
- challenge (12)
-
delete
_ passwd (12) - digest (204)
- file (24)
- flush (12)
-
get
_ passwd (12) - hexdigest (180)
- hexencode (12)
-
make
_ passwd (12) - new (252)
-
pbkdf2
_ hmac (12) -
pkcs5
_ keyivgen (12) -
set
_ passwd (12) - sign (60)
- update (24)
- verify (12)
検索結果
先頭5件
-
Digest
. # hexencode(string) -> String (21126.0) -
引数である文字列 string を、16進数に変換した文字列を生成して返します。
...て返します。
@param string 文字列を指定します。
//emlist[][ruby]{
require 'digest'
p Digest.hexencode("") # => ""
p Digest.hexencode("d") # => "64"
p Digest.hexencode("\1\2") # => "0102"
p Digest.hexencode("\xB0") # => "b0"
p digest = Digest::MD5.digest("ruby") # => "X\x......DF"
p Digest.hexencode(digest) # => "58e53d1324eef6265fdb97b08ed9aadf"
p Digest::MD5.hexdigest("ruby") # => "58e53d1324eef6265fdb97b08ed9aadf"
p digest = Digest::SHA1.digest("ruby") # => "\x18\xE4\x0E\x14\x01\xEE\xF6~\x1A\xE6\x9E\xFA\xB0\x9A\xFBq\xF8\x7F\xFB\x81"
p Digest.hex......encode(digest) # => "18e40e1401eef67e1ae69efab09afb71f87ffb81"
p Digest::SHA1.hexdigest("ruby") # => "18e40e1401eef67e1ae69efab09afb71f87ffb81"
//}
文字列から16進数に変換したハッシュ値を直接得たい場合は、Digest::Base.hexdigest を使うこともで... -
Digest
. # bubblebabble(string) -> String (21006.0) -
与えられた文字列を BubbleBabble エンコードした文字列を返します。
...与えられた文字列を BubbleBabble エンコードした文字列を返します。
@param string 文字列を指定します。... -
Kernel
# Digest(name) -> object (18173.0) -
"MD5"や"SHA1"などのダイジェストを示す文字列 name を指定し、 対応するダイジェストのクラスを取得します。
...@param name "MD5"や"SHA1"などのダイジェストを示す文字列を指定します。
@return Digest::MD5やDigest::SHA1などの対応するダイジェストのクラスを返します。インスタンスではなく、クラスを返します。注意してください。
例: Digest::......MD、Digest::SHA1、Digest::SHA512のクラス名を順番に出力する。
require 'digest'
for a in ["MD5", "SHA1", "SHA512"]
p Digest(a) # => Digest::MD5, Digest::SHA1, Digest::SHA512
end......境で
Digest::MD5などを直接呼び出すと問題があるときはこのメソッドを使
うか、起動時に使用するライブラリを Kernel.#require してください。
@param name "MD5"や"SHA1"などのダイジェストを示す文字列を指定します。
@return Digest::MD5......スタンスではなく、クラスを返します。注意してください。
例: Digest::MD、Digest::SHA1、Digest::SHA512のクラス名を順番に出力する。
require 'digest'
for a in ["MD5", "SHA1", "SHA512"]
p Digest(a) # => Digest::MD5, Digest::SHA1, Digest::SHA512
end... -
OpenSSL
:: Digest . digest(name , data) -> String (9113.0) -
data のダイジェストを計算します。
...data のダイジェストを計算します。
name でハッシュ関数を指定します。
@param name ハッシュ関数の種類を文字列("md5", "sha256" など)で指定
@param data ダイジェストを計算する文字列... -
Gem
:: DigestAdapter # digest(string) -> String (9107.0) -
@todo
...@todo
与えられた文字列のダイジェストを返します。
@param string ダイジェストを取得したい文字列を指定します。... -
OpenSSL
:: Digest :: DSS . digest(data) -> String (9107.0) -
data のダイジェストを DSS で計算します。
...data のダイジェストを DSS で計算します。
@param data ダイジェストを計算する文字列... -
OpenSSL
:: Digest :: DSS1 . digest(data) -> String (9107.0) -
data のダイジェストを DSS1 で計算します。
...data のダイジェストを DSS1 で計算します。
@param data ダイジェストを計算する文字列... -
OpenSSL
:: Digest :: MD2 . digest(data) -> String (9107.0) -
data のダイジェストを MD2 で計算します。
...data のダイジェストを MD2 で計算します。
@param data ダイジェストを計算する文字列... -
OpenSSL
:: Digest :: MD4 . digest(data) -> String (9107.0) -
data のダイジェストを MD4 で計算します。
...data のダイジェストを MD4 で計算します。
@param data ダイジェストを計算する文字列...